일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| 2 | |||||
3 | 4 | 5 | 6 | 7 | 8 | 9 |
10 | 11 | 12 | 13 | 14 | 15 | 16 |
17 | 18 | 19 | 20 | 21 | 22 | 23 |
24 | 25 | 26 | 27 | 28 | 29 | 30 |
- 레벨2
- 웹
- sts
- 웹 프로그래밍
- 서버
- AI Tech 4기
- 백엔드
- 4기
- 2021 Dev-matching 웹 백엔드 개발자
- 풀스택
- 부스트캠프
- Customer service 구현
- 백준
- 네이버
- Naver boostcourse
- Naver boostcamp
- cs50
- P Stage
- 구현
- BOJ
- boostcourse
- Django
- 프로그래머스
- 장고
- QNA 봇
- AI Tech
- 파이썬
- 서블릿
- 대회
- 프로그래밍
- Today
- Total
목록구현 (2)
daniel7481의 개발일지
P stage가 끝난 기념 폭풍같이 블로그를 작성하고 있다. 이 때가 아니면 또 잊어버릴 수도 있기에, 이번에 구현했던 wand와 sweep 구현을 적어보려고 한다. Wandb wandb.login(key = wandb_dict[cfg.wandb.wandb_username]) model_name_ch = re.sub('/','_',cfg.model.model_name) wandb_logger = WandbLogger( log_model="all", name=f'{model_name_ch}_{cfg.train.batch_size}_{cfg.train.learning_rate}_{time_now}', project=cfg.wandb.wandb_project, entity=cfg.wandb.wandb_enti..
문제 1부터 N까지의 수를 이어서 쓰면 다음과 같이 새로운 하나의 수를 얻을 수 있다. 1234567891011121314151617181920212223... 이렇게 만들어진 새로운 수는 몇 자리 수일까? 이 수의 자릿수를 구하는 프로그램을 작성하시오. 입력 첫째 줄에 N(1 ≤ N ≤ 100,000,000)이 주어진다. 출력 첫째 줄에 새로운 수의 자릿수를 출력한다. 풀이 요즘 알고리즘을 풀면서 벽을 느끼고 있다.... 자신감도 떨어지고 그런거 같아서 실버 문제를 풀어보기로 했다. 역시 돌고 돌아 구현이라고 구현 문제로 돌아왔다. 1자리 수는 1개의 자리를 차지하고, 10 자리수는 2개의 자리수를 차지하고 이렇게 계속 더해주는식으로 문제를 풀어보려고 했다. 1~9까지는 9개, 10~99까지는 90개...